html{ -webkit-text-size-adjust:none;}
body{font:12px/1.5em Tahoma,Arial,'\5b8b\4f53',sans-serif; word-break:break-all; word-wrap:break-word;}
body,table,tr,td,ul,li,div,span,h1,h2,h3,h4,h5,h6,p,pre,form,fieldset,input,ol,dl,dd,dt,th,thead,tbody,tfoot,blockquote,iframe{margin:0; padding:0;}
h1,h2,h3,h4,h5,h6,p,a{font-size:100%;}
ul,ol,li{list-style:none;}
table{border-collapse:collapse; border-style:none;}
img{border:none;}
a{color:#000;text-decoration:none;}
a:hover{text-decoration:underline;}
.red{color:#ff0000;}

.body_bg{background:url(../images/body_bg.jpg) center 0 no-repeat;}
.wrap{width:960px;margin:0 auto;}
.header{position:relative;height:406px;background:url(../images/top01.jpg) no-repeat;}
.link_logo{position:absolute;top:10px;left:-155px;display:block;width:185px;height:95px;text-indent:-999em;}
.link_btn_get,
.link_btn_enter,
.link_btn_game{position:absolute;top:281px;display:block;width:174px;height:44px;background:url(../images/link_btn.png) no-repeat;text-indent:-999em;}
.link_btn_get{left:-25px;background-position:0 0;}
.link_btn_get:hover{background-position:0 -50px;}
.link_btn_enter{left:173px;background-position:0 -100px;}
.link_btn_enter:hover{background-position:0 -150px;}
.link_btn_game{left:368px;background-position:0 -200px;}
.link_btn_game:hover{background-position:0 -250px;}

.middle{position:relative;height:575px;background:url(../images/middle.jpg) no-repeat;line-height:20px;color:#09909f;}
.middle_txt01{position:absolute;top:86px;left:60px;}
.tabArea{margin-top:5px;}
.tabArea td{padding:3px 0;}
.tabArea input{width:93px;height:16px;margin-left:3px;padding:2px 0;line-height:16px;border:1px solid #7ac5c7;background:#fff;color:#09909f;}
.tabArea .jh{display:block;width:60px;height:47px;margin-left:10px;background:url(../images/jh.png) no-repeat;text-indent:-999em;}
.middle_txt02{position:absolute;top:480px;left:63px;}

.bottom{position:relative;height:402px;background:url(../images/bottom.jpg) no-repeat;color:#09909f;line-height:20px;}
.bottom_txt01{position:absolute;top:28px;left:495px;}
.bottom_txt02{position:absolute;top:80px;left:60px;font-size:14px;line-height:24px;}

.logoShowList{position:absolute;bottom:28px;left:40px;width:878px;height:144px;}
.scrollBar{height:144px;}
.scrollBox{}
.scrollBox .pcont {width:878px;float:left;overflow:hidden;}
.scrollBox .ScrCont {width:32766px; margin-left:5px;}
.scrollBox #List1_1, .scrollBox #List2_1 {float:left;}
.scrollBox .LeftBotton, .scrollBox .RightBotton {width:48px;height:131px;float:left;background:url(../images/lbtn.jpg) no-repeat; cursor:pointer}
.scrollBox .LeftBotton { background-position: 0 0;cursor:pointer}
.scrollBox .RightBotton {background-position: 0 -146px;cursor:pointer}
.scrollBox .LeftBotton:hover { background-position: -53px 0;cursor:pointer}
.scrollBox .RightBotton:hover { background-position:-53px -146px;cursor:pointer}
.scroll-list li{float:left; padding:22px 16px;}
.scroll-list li img{ display:block;}

.footer{height:167px;background:url(../images/footer_bg.png) repeat-x;}
.left_layout{padding-top:20px;padding-left:140px;zoom:1;}
.left_layout:after{ content:"."; display:block; height:0; clear:both; overflow:hidden;}
.left_layout .side{ float:left; display:inline; margin-right:30px; _margin-right:27px;}
.left_layout .main{ display:block;padding-top:33px; overflow:hidden; zoom:1;line-height:20px;}
.left_layout .main a:hover{color:#fff;text-decoration:none;}

/******** µ¯³ö²ã *********/
.popup_box{position:absolute;top:50%;left:50%;margin-left:-250px;margin-top:-50px;width:500px;border-radius:4px;background:#fff;border:1px solid #e0effc;}
.popup_box .header{height:35px;padding:0 10px;background:#548bdd;line-height:35px;border-radius:4px 4px 0 0;}
.popup_box .header .h_l{float:left;font:18px/1.8em Microsoft YaHei,'\5b8b\4f53', sans-serif;color:#fff;}
.popup_box .header .close{float:right;margin-top:12px;}
.popup_box .header .close a{width:9px;height:9px;display:block;background:url(../images/icon.png) no-repeat;-moz-transition:0.5s;-webkit-transition:0.5s;-o-transition:0.5s;transition:0.5s;}
.popup_box .header .close a:hover{-moz-transform:rotate(90deg);-webkit-transform:rotate(90deg);-o-transform:rotate(90deg);transform:rotate(90deg);}
.popup_box .main{padding:20px 10px;text-align:center;}